Essential Ingredients for Your Delicious Breakfast Burritos
As I’ve mentioned, this breakfast burrito recipe is entirely customizable to suit your palate and whatever ingredients you have on hand. However, for a truly delicious and classic flavor profile, here is my absolute favorite combination of ingredients:
- Ground Breakfast Sausage: The star of the show, providing a savory and satisfying base. Choose your preferred variety, mild or spicy.
- Onion: Finely chopped, it adds a foundational aromatic sweetness and depth to the filling.
- Red Pepper Flakes: Just a touch provides a subtle warmth and gentle heat, enhancing the overall flavor without being overpowering.
- Dried Cilantro: Offers a bright, herbaceous note that complements the Mexican-inspired flavors beautifully.
- Minced Garlic: Essential for its pungent aroma and robust flavor, garlic elevates the savory components of the burrito.
- Colored Bell Peppers: A medley of red, yellow, and green bell peppers not only adds vibrant color but also a crisp texture and a touch of natural sweetness.
- Salt & Pepper: Simple but crucial seasonings to bring all the flavors together and enhance the taste of every component. Season to your personal preference.
- Eggs: Fluffy scrambled eggs are a classic and essential binder, adding richness and protein to the burrito.
- Shredded Cheddar Cheese: Melty, sharp cheddar cheese provides a creamy texture and a delightful tang that pulls all the ingredients into a cohesive, comforting bite.
- Flour Tortillas: Large, soft flour tortillas are necessary for wrapping all these delicious fillings. Opt for “burrito size” to ensure ample space for rolling.
How to Craft the Perfect Make-Ahead Breakfast Burritos: A Step-by-Step Guide
Creating these delicious breakfast burritos is surprisingly straightforward. Follow these simple steps for a satisfying meal prep experience:
Begin by preheating your oven to a robust 425 degrees Fahrenheit. This ensures it’s perfectly hot and ready when your burritos are assembled.
In a large skillet, crumble and brown your ground breakfast sausage. As it cooks, add the chopped onion, a pinch of red pepper flakes for a gentle kick, minced garlic, and the dried cilantro. Continue to cook, stirring occasionally, until the meat is about halfway cooked through. At this point, toss in the colorful chopped bell peppers. Continue cooking the mixture until the sausage is fully cooked and no longer pink, and the vegetables have softened to your liking, taking on a slight char for added flavor.

Next, in a separate bowl, beat the eggs vigorously with a generous amount of salt and pepper. Seasoning the eggs well is key to a flavorful burrito.

Once the sausage and vegetable mixture is cooked, remove it from the pan and set it aside. Add the beaten eggs into the same hot skillet and scramble them until they are set but still soft and moist. Once scrambled, return the cooked meat and vegetable mixture to the pan with the eggs and gently mix everything together, ensuring an even distribution of all the delicious fillings.

To assemble your burritos, lay a flour tortilla flat. Place a generous scoop of the sausage and egg mixture (approximately 2/3 cup or so) slightly off-center on the tortilla. Then, sprinkle generously with freshly shredded cheddar cheese. Freshly grated cheese melts much better and tastes superior to pre-shredded varieties.

Carefully fold the sides of the tortilla inwards, over the filling, creating neat, enclosed ends. This helps to contain the filling and prevents it from spilling out.

Next, fold the bottom edge of the tortilla up and over the egg mixture, tightly tucking it in. Then, continue to roll the burrito upwards and away from you, keeping the roll as snug as possible, until you have a perfectly sealed burrito.

Once assembled, place the burritos seam-side down on a large cookie sheet. Bake them in the preheated oven for 10 minutes, or until the tortillas are lightly golden and the filling is heated through. Serve them piping hot with your favorite salsa for an extra burst of flavor!
Expert Tips for Flawless Breakfast Burritos
- Warm Your Tortillas: Before assembling, gently warm your tortillas in the microwave for 15-20 seconds or on a dry skillet for a few seconds per side. This makes them more pliable and less likely to tear when rolling.
- Don’t Overfill: While tempting to pack in as much as possible, overfilling can make burritos difficult to roll and prone to bursting. Stick to about 2/3 cup of filling.
- Season Generously: Taste your sausage and egg mixture before assembling and adjust salt and pepper as needed. Properly seasoned layers are key to a delicious burrito.
- Evenly Distribute Filling: Spread the filling in a rectangular shape slightly below the center of the tortilla, leaving enough space at the top and sides for folding.
- Roll Tightly: A tight roll ensures the burrito holds its shape and keeps all the fillings secure, especially important for freezing and reheating.
- Use Good Quality Ingredients: Fresh bell peppers, quality sausage, and good cheese make a noticeable difference in flavor.

Make-Ahead & Freezer-Friendly: Your Grab-and-Go Solution
The true magic of these breakfast burritos lies in their incredible make-ahead and freezer-friendly nature. When you’re preparing a batch, seriously consider doubling or even tripling the recipe to stock your freezer. This way, you’ll have a convenient and delicious meal ready to go whenever you need it. Grab them one at a time for a quick weekday breakfast, or bake enough for the entire family for a relaxed weekend brunch that everyone will undoubtedly enjoy.
How to Freeze Breakfast Burritos: Once your burritos are baked and perfectly cooked, allow them to cool completely to room temperature. This is crucial to prevent ice crystals from forming. Once cool, wrap each individual burrito tightly in aluminum foil. Then, place the foil-wrapped burritos into a large, freezer-safe ziplock bag or an airtight container. They can be safely stored in the freezer for up to 3 months, ready to be enjoyed at a moment’s notice.
How to Re-Heat Frozen Burritos: To reheat from frozen, there’s no need to thaw! Simply place the foil-wrapped burritos directly onto a cookie sheet. Bake them in a preheated oven at 425 degrees Fahrenheit for approximately 1 hour, or until they are thoroughly heated through to the center. For a quicker option, remove the foil, wrap in a damp paper towel, and microwave for 2-3 minutes, flipping halfway, then crisp in a hot skillet or air fryer if desired.
How to Refrigerate and Re-Heat Breakfast Burritos
For shorter-term storage, after you bake the burritos, you can easily store them in the refrigerator. Simply place them in an airtight container once they’ve cooled completely. They will stay fresh and delicious for up to 3 days. To reheat them directly from the fridge, place them in the oven at 425 degrees Fahrenheit and bake for about 10 minutes, or until the filling is piping hot and the tortilla is slightly crispy. Alternatively, you can microwave them for 1-2 minutes until warmed through.
The air fryer also proves to be a fantastic tool for warming these burritos back up! While all air fryers vary slightly in their performance, mine typically warms them up in approximately half the time compared to a conventional oven, using the same temperature setting. This method often yields a wonderfully crispy exterior.
Endless Customization: Creative Breakfast Burrito Ideas
The beauty of this recipe lies in its adaptability. As long as you maintain similar amounts of core ingredients, you can effortlessly switch up the flavors to create an entirely new experience. Here are some fantastic ideas to spark your culinary creativity:
- Meat Variations: For a more authentic Mexican flair, consider swapping the breakfast sausage for spicy chorizo. If you prefer poultry, ground chicken or turkey can be seasoned with your favorite taco or fajita spices to create a lean yet flavorful alternative to pork sausage.
- Spice Them Up: If you love heat, finely chopped fresh jalapeño or serrano peppers can be added along with the bell peppers. For an extra kick, a dash of your favorite hot sauce or a sprinkle of cayenne pepper in the egg mixture works wonders.
- Vegetarian Options: To make these burritos vegetarian, simply omit the sausage and significantly increase the amount of vegetables. Sautéed mushrooms, finely chopped broccoli, fresh spinach (added at the end to wilt), seasoned pinto or black beans, perfectly roasted potatoes, or diced fresh tomatoes would all be magnificent additions or alternatives to meat. You could also use a plant-based breakfast crumble.
- Vegan Alternatives: For a fully vegan version, substitute the breakfast sausage with a vegan sausage crumble, use a plant-based egg substitute for the eggs, and choose your favorite dairy-free shredded cheese. The array of vegan products available today makes this an easy and delicious swap!
- Additional Fillings: Consider adding cooked quinoa or rice for extra texture and substance. A dollop of sour cream or Greek yogurt, a slice of avocado, or a sprinkle of fresh chopped cilantro just before serving can elevate the flavors even further.
- Cheese Choices: While cheddar is a classic, feel free to experiment with Monterey Jack, pepper jack for a spicy kick, or even a Mexican blend cheese for variety.

Breakfast Burritos
Equipment
-
13×18 Half Sheet Pan
-
Lodge Pre-Seasoned Cast Iron Skillet With Assist Handle, 10.25″, Black
Ingredients
- 16 ounces ground breakfast sausage
- 1 cup onion chopped
- 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es
- 1 1/2 teaspoons dried cilantro
- 2 cloves minced garlic
- 1 1/4 cup colored bell peppers
- Salt & Pepper to taste
- 8 eggs beaten
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 8 burrito sized flour tortillas
Instructions
-
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 C).
-
In a large skillet, crumble and brown the ground breakfast sausage with chopped onion, red pepper flakes, minced garlic, and dried cilantro. Once the meat is about halfway cooked, add in the chopped bell peppers. Continue cooking until the sausage is fully cooked and the vegetables are tender.
-
In a separate bowl, beat the eggs together with salt and pepper until well combined. Remove the cooked meat and vegetable mixture from the skillet and set aside. Pour the beaten eggs into the same pan and scramble until just set. Return the meat mixture to the pan with the scrambled eggs and mix thoroughly.
-
To assemble the burritos: Lay a tortilla flat. Add approximately 2/3 cup of the sausage-egg mixture to the center of each tortilla. Sprinkle with shredded cheddar cheese. Fold the left and right sides of the tortilla inwards, then fold the bottom edge over the filling. Roll up tightly from the bottom to create a compact burrito.
-
Place the assembled burritos seam-side down on a baking sheet.
-
Bake for 10 minutes, or until the tortillas are lightly golden and the filling is heated through. Serve hot with your favorite salsa.
Notes
To reheat frozen burritos: Place the foil-wrapped burrito on a cookie sheet. Bake in a preheated 425 degree F (220 C) oven for approximately 1 hour, or until heated through. Alternatively, remove foil, wrap in a damp paper towel, microwave for 2-3 minutes, then crisp in a skillet or air fryer if desired.
If storing burritos in the fridge: Keep in an airtight container and consume within 3 days. Reheat in a 425F oven for 10 minutes or microwave for 1-2 minutes.
